The American Association for Justice has published its ten worst insurance companies for consumers. Forget what you see on TV, as a consumer you are not in good hands with Allstate, as they lead the list. As a consumer, let the buyer beware, each of the top ten companies will use various tactics to increase profit. The more you know as a consumer about the realities of the insurance business, the better you can decide which company will protect you and your family when you need the coverage you buy.
